Factor In Supplementary Charges
Planning a budget for party rentals requires more than just cataloging the essential equipment. It demands taking into account various extra costs that can significantly affect the overall budget. Delivery fees, setup and breakdown charges, and possible damage deposits are frequent expenses that often surprise. Furthermore, some rentals might include additional costs for specialized equipment or accessories, like lighting or sound systems. Taxes and insurance must also be considered, since they contribute to the total expenses. To prevent surprises, individuals should ask about all potential fees upfront, ensuring a comprehensive understanding of the financial obligations involved. By factoring in these extra costs, planners can create a realistic budget that fits their event objectives.

What Questions Should You Ask Rental Companies?
When planning an event, what vital questions should one ask to rental companies to guarantee a trouble-free experience? First, inquire about stock levels on the desired date. This confirms that the needed items can be booked in advance. Next, ask for a full catalog of supplies, including sizes, colors, and quantities. Grasping what is offered helps in conducting careful decisions.
Also, clarifying the rental details is crucial; inquiries about transport fees, arrangement and cleanup services, and cancellation policies can prevent conflicts later. It is also significant to learn about deposit requirements and payment schedules.
In addition, interested clients should ask about insurance coverage and what happens in event of damage or loss. Finally, checking client testimonials or recommendations can offer understanding into the firm's reliability. These questions facilitate well-considered choices, eventually leading to a successful event.

Commonly Posed Questions
How far in beforehand ought to I book Party Rentals?
Authorities recommend booking party rentals at minimum 4-6 weeks ahead. This timeframe secures supply, allows for modifications, and affords ample occasion to coordinate logistics for a effective event minus last-minute stress.
What Rental Items Tend to Be Most Harmed?
Rental items that are frequently harmed include tents, tables, and chairs, typically because of environmental exposure or improper handling. Additionally, glassware and decorative items regularly endure breakage, demanding careful management during events to limit potential loss.
Is it Feasible for Me to Retrieve Equipment on My Own?
Most equipment rental firms allow customers to collect products on their own. However, terms may differ, so it's advisable to confirm details directly with the rental service to ensure a seamless and quick collection procedure.
What Occurs if My Function Is Canceled?
If an event is canceled, the rental company typically has a cancellation procedure in place. This may entail partial reimbursements or rescheduling options, depending on the timing and particular conditions outlined in the rental agreement.
Do Delivery Fees Typically Factor in Rental Costs?
Delivery fees usually aren't part of rental expenses. Most rental companies charge separately for delivery, installation, and retrieval, which can vary based on distance and the complexity of the event logistics.
